Guinea - Groundnut Oil Demand
Since 2014, Guinea Groundnut Oil Demand rose 2.9%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 6 comparing other countries in Groundnut Oil Demand at 113 Thousand Metric Tons. Guinea is overtaken by United States, which was ranked number 5 with 128 Thousand Metric Tons and is followed by Senegal at 86 Thousand Metric Tons. China topped the ranking with 1,961 Thousand Metric Tons in 2019, +0.2% versus 2018. India, Nigeria and Myanmar resp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king.
